The first steps into the trail running adventure
Running & Easy Trails
These routes are ideal for getting started. Simple and short running routes on asphalt, forest and gravel roads await you on running routes. Like here, for example, on the large panoramic running circuit, which takes you 14 km right across Schladming. The Rohrmoos running circuit, for example, offers a combination of running and trail running routes, leading through meadows and forests and offering wonderful views of the surrounding mountains. It is one of the easy trails that lead you slightly uphill and downhill over various surfaces.
Take yourself to the next level
Medium trails
Those who prefer something a little more challenging will find what they are looking for on routes such as the Freienstein Sprintrail, the Klamm Trail or the Hochwurzen Trail. On these tours, you are partly in alpine terrain and have to cover a few meters in altitude. You can find more information on the length and intensity of the trail running routes here.
The Torlauf Dachstein is also a spectacular challenge for all racing enthusiasts. The marathon distance (42 km) will really get your pulse racing. In addition to trails along a breathtaking landscape at the foot of the Dachstein, a via ferrata passage awaits you on this route.
If that's a step too steep for you, you can also take part in the half marathon, the 10 km lap or the relay race at this legendary running event. This year, the starting shot will be fired on 07.09. You can find more information here.
